Possible Causes of Water Damage in Nashville Homes and Businesses

Water damage in Nashville can result from a variety of sources. One common cause is burst or leaking pipes, which may occur due to aging infrastructure or sudden freezing temperatures that cause pipes to crack. When these pipes rupture, they can release large amounts of water quickly, leading to significant damage if not addressed promptly.

Another frequent cause is water intrusion from storms or heavy rainfalls. Nashville’s weather can sometimes bring heavy thunderstorms, leading to flooding or seepage through foundation cracks. Additionally, plumbing failures, appliance malfunctions, or roof leaks can contribute to water accumulation inside your property, leading to long-term damage if neglected.

How do I know if my water damage is Category 1, 2, or 3?

We assess the water source, contamination levels, and affected materials during our inspection. Category 1 water is clean, while Category 2 has some contamination, and Category 3, often called black water, is highly contaminated and hazardous. Our experts classify water damage accurately to determine the best remediation approach.

Can water damage be prevented in Nashville homes?

Yes, regular maintenance, such as inspecting plumbing systems, sealing foundation cracks, and installing proper drainage, can prevent water intrusion. Promptly addressing leaks and storm preparedness are also key steps to safeguard your property from water damage.
